Wed Dec 10, 2025 · 07:00 PM

VIRTUAL Council

Innisfil Council discusses 2026 budget and property tax increases

Council is reviewing the 2026 Operating and Capital Budget, which includes a proposed 5.50% average residential property tax increase. The meeting also includes presentations on the South Simcoe Police Service budget and the Long-Range Financial Plan.

Tue Nov 18, 2025 · 05:30 PM

Traffic Safety Advisory Committee

All-way stop recommended at 10th Line and 25 Sideroad

The Traffic Safety Advisory Committee will receive a staff recommendation to install an all-way stop at the intersection of 10th Line and 25 Sideroad, based on a traffic study that met volume warrants but not collision warrants. The committee will also receive updates on automated speed enforcement, a traffic light at 20 Sideroad and Big Bay Point Road, and a County of Simcoe road project. A discussion on ATV/dirt bike use in the community is scheduled, and proposed 2026 meeting dates will be considered.

Special Council

Innisfil council hears public input on proposed wastewater treatment plant development charge hikes

This special council meeting is a public consultation on a draft amendment to the town's development charges for wastewater treatment, driven by cost increases for the Phase 3 expansion of the Lakeshore Water Pollution Control Plant. Council will receive comments on the proposed rate increases and a separate application for an official plan amendment, zoning by-law amendment, and draft plan of subdivision at 1015 Cumberland Street. No final decisions are being made at this meeting; comments will inform future recommendation reports.
